Transaction c76928f53f9d8db4bb4c3e3f46c06d94d2a0146f4fc4299de93ea0be120b661f

56 Input
2 Outputs
  • c76928f53f9d8db4bb4c3e3f46c06d94d2a0146f4fc4299de93ea0be120b661f:0
  • value  734032
    address  1MoFXPMx263T3C2GWvgYMjToSLYdwbfHjv
  • c76928f53f9d8db4bb4c3e3f46c06d94d2a0146f4fc4299de93ea0be120b661f:1
  • value  1287398747
    address  16cZHNFFBk8UuVJZmp8XQ8nEzbCj6nPTUc